Home
last modified time | relevance | path

Searched refs:nrFreeVariables (Results 1 – 14 of 14) sorted by relevance

/dports/lang/maude/maude-2.7.1/src/Higher/
H A DvariantSearch.hh54 const Vector<DagNode*>* getNextVariant(int& nrFreeVariables, int& parentIndex, bool& moreInLayer);
55 const Vector<DagNode*>* getNextUnifier(int& nrFreeVariables);
61 …const Vector<DagNode*>* getLastReturnedVariant(int& nrFreeVariables, int& parentIndex, bool& moreI…
65 const Vector<DagNode*>* getLastReturnedUnifier(int& nrFreeVariables);
114 VariantSearch::getLastReturnedUnifier(int& nrFreeVariables) in getLastReturnedUnifier() argument
116 return variantCollection.getLastReturnedVariant(nrFreeVariables); in getLastReturnedUnifier()
H A DvariantSearch.cc208 VariantSearch::getNextVariant(int& nrFreeVariables, int& parentIndex, bool& moreInLayer) in getNextVariant() argument
217 …variantCollection.getNextSurvivingVariant(nrFreeVariables, &variantNumber, &parentNumber, &moreInL… in getNextVariant()
224 …v = variantCollection.getNextSurvivingVariant(nrFreeVariables, &variantNumber, &parentNumber, &mor… in getNextVariant()
241 VariantSearch::getLastReturnedVariant(int& nrFreeVariables, int& parentIndex, bool& moreInLayer) in getLastReturnedVariant() argument
244 …const Vector<DagNode*>* v = variantCollection.getLastReturnedVariant(nrFreeVariables, &parentNumbe… in getLastReturnedVariant()
251 VariantSearch::getNextUnifier(int& nrFreeVariables) in getNextUnifier() argument
255 const Vector<DagNode*>* v = variantCollection.getNextSurvivingVariant(nrFreeVariables); in getNextUnifier()
264 v = variantCollection.getNextSurvivingVariant(nrFreeVariables); in getNextUnifier()
H A DvariantFolder.cc232 VariantFolder::getNextSurvivingVariant(int& nrFreeVariables, int* variantNumber, int* parentNumber,… in getNextSurvivingVariant() argument
239 nrFreeVariables = nextVariant->second->nrFreeVariables; in getNextSurvivingVariant()
265 VariantFolder::getLastReturnedVariant(int& nrFreeVariables, int* parentNumber, bool* moreInLayer) in getLastReturnedVariant() argument
269 nrFreeVariables = currentVariant->second->nrFreeVariables; in getLastReturnedVariant()
359 nrFreeVariables = variableInfo.getNrRealVariables(); in RetainedVariant()
H A DvariantFolder.hh54 const Vector<DagNode*>* getNextSurvivingVariant(int& nrFreeVariables,
62 const Vector<DagNode*>* getLastReturnedVariant(int& nrFreeVariables,
74 int nrFreeVariables; // number of variables occuring in variant member
H A DunificationProblem.cc371 int nrFreeVariables = freeVariables.size(); in findOrderSortedUnifiers() local
373 for (int i = 0; i < nrFreeVariables; ++i) in findOrderSortedUnifiers()
407 if (nrFreeVariables > 0) in findOrderSortedUnifiers()
H A DChangeLog659 * variantSearch.hh (getNextVariant): pass back nrFreeVariables
661 * variantSearch.cc (expand): commented out nrFreeVariables change
667 * variantFolder.cc (RetainedVariant): fill out nrFreeVariables
668 (getNextSurvivingVariant): return nrFreeVariables
674 pass nrFreeVariables to insertUnifier()
675 (findNextVariant): get nrFreeVariables from
678 * unifierFilter.hh (SimpleRootContainer): add nrFreeVariables to
682 * unifierFilter.cc (getNextSurvivingUnifier): return nrFreeVariables
683 (insertUnifier): store nrFreeVariables
/dports/lang/maude/maude-2.7.1/src/Meta/
H A DmetaVariant.cc101 int nrFreeVariables; in metaGetVariant2() local
111 variant = vs->getLastReturnedVariant(nrFreeVariables, parentIndex, moreInLayer); in metaGetVariant2()
117 variant = vs->getNextVariant(nrFreeVariables, parentIndex, moreInLayer); in metaGetVariant2()
132 mpz_class lastVarIndex = varIndex + nrFreeVariables; in metaGetVariant2()
216 int nrFreeVariables; in metaVariantUnify2() local
223 unifier = vs->getLastReturnedUnifier(nrFreeVariables); in metaVariantUnify2()
229 unifier = vs->getNextUnifier(nrFreeVariables); in metaVariantUnify2()
244 mpz_class lastVarIndex = varIndex + nrFreeVariables; in metaVariantUnify2()
/dports/lang/maude/maude-2.7.1/src/Utility/
H A DmpzGcdInit.cc106 nrFreeVariables = nrVariables - nrEquations; in integerGaussianElimination()
114 for (int j = 0; j < nrFreeVariables; j++) in integerGaussianElimination()
174 int nrEquations = nrVariables - nrFreeVariables; in initializeGcd()
178 int nrGcds = nrFreeVariables - 1; in initializeGcd()
241 for (int i = nrFreeVariables - 1; i >= 0; i--) in initializeGcd()
285 stack.resize(nrFreeVariables); in initializeGcd()
H A DmpzGcdBasedSolver.cc72 for (; sp < nrFreeVariables; ++sp) in nextSolution()
74 if (!((sp == nrFreeVariables - 1) ? fillOutLastEntry() : fillOutStackEntry(sp))) in nextSolution()
83 sp = nrFreeVariables; in nextSolution()
246 int prediag = nrFreeVariables - 1; in fillOutLastEntry()
410 for (int i = nrFreeVariables - 1; i >= 0; --i) in solveDiagonal()
H A DmpzSystem.hh121 int nrFreeVariables; // free variables are those not on the diagonal member in MpzSystem
H A DChangeLog756 * mpzGcdBasedSolver.cc (nextSolution): handle nrFreeVariables == 0
770 * mpzGcdInit.cc (integerGaussianElimination): initialize nrFreeVariables
778 by nrFreeVariables
/dports/lang/maude/maude-2.7.1/src/Mixfix/
H A Dsearch.cc464 int nrFreeVariables; in getVariants() local
467 …while (counter != limit && (variant = vs.getNextVariant(nrFreeVariables, parentIndex, moreInLayer)… in getVariants()
563 int nrFreeVariables; in variantUnify() local
564 while (counter != limit && (unifier = vs.getNextUnifier(nrFreeVariables))) in variantUnify()
/dports/lang/maude/maude-2.7.1/src/FreeTheory/
H A DfreeRemainder.cc92 int nrFreeVariables = freeVars.length(); in FreeRemainder() local
93 for (int i = 0; i < nrFreeVariables; i++) in FreeRemainder()
H A DChangeLog1231 nrFreeVariables
1236 (class FreeRemainder): delete data member nrFreeVariables
1258 nrFreeVariables until we have processed pseudo variables which
1265 nrFreeVariables, equation
1268 nrFreeVariables; made foreign const